Help Columbus and Bluetooth Coding Problem

Featured Replies

I installed a Columbus and bluetooth in my FL Octavia. The Columbus has 2684 firmware so has voice control. The Bluetooth is 1Z0 035 729 E. All worked fine I then asked my local dealer to code the car for the additions. The maxidot now displays Audio and Sat Nav fine, but no Telephone and the Voice control is now disabled. One of the Bluetooth Modules (and i think yours is one of them) doesn't display the phone option on the Maxidot.

You should still however have the functionality from the MFD3.

With regards to Voice Control it is hit and miss for it Working. 2684 was supposed to fix this problem from 2660. However it appears it hasn't.

I tried for 7 hours the other day to get it to work in a mates car. I also know of at least one other person who also had a 5 hour Epic that couldn't be sorted.
